Understanding UK Casino Licensing and Regulation
The United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C) is the primary regulatory body responsible for overseeing all forms of gambling within the UK. This includes online casinos. A casino holding a UKGC license adheres to stringent standards regarding player protection, fair gaming, and anti-money laundering practices. Before committing any funds to an online casino, verifying its license status is arguably the most critical step. The UKGC publishes a public register of licensed operators, allowing players to quickly confirm the legitimacy of a casino. Ignoring this essential measure can leave individuals vulnerable to fraudulent activities and potential financial losses. Furthermore, licensed casinos are subject to regular audits to ensure ongoing compliance, offering an additional layer of security.
Beyond the UKGC license, reputable casinos often display badges and certifications from independent testing agencies such as eCOGRA and iTech Labs. These agencies rigorously test the fairness of casino games, using Random Number Generators (RNGs) to guarantee unbiased results. The presence of such certifications provides assurance that the games are demonstrably fair, and not manipulated in favor of the casino. It’s also worth considering the casino’s reputation within the online gambling community. Reading reviews from other players can provide valuable insights into the casino's customer service, payout speeds, and overall trustworthiness. A consistently positive reputation is a strong indicator of a reliable and player-friendly operator.
Key Features of a UKGC Licensed Casino
A casino licensed by the UKGC typically exhibits specific characteristics that distinguish it from unregulated platforms. These include robust security measures, such as SSL encryption, to protect player data and financial transactions. They are also required to implement responsible gambling tools,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options, to help players manage their gambling habits. Furthermore, UKGC-licensed casinos must clearly display terms and conditions, including wagering requirements for bonuses, in a transparent and understandable manner. They are also obligated to handle player complaints fairly and efficiently, adhering to a defined complaints procedure. These features collectively contribute to a safer and more secure gaming experience for players.
The importance of adhering to these standards cannot be overstated. Unlicensed casinos operate outside the scope of regulatory oversight, leaving players with little recourse in the event of disputes or fraudulent activity. They may also employ unfair game mechanics, withhold payouts, or engage in other unethical practices. Choosing a UKGC-licensed casino is, therefore, not merely a matter of preference, but a fundamental requirement for responsible online gambling. It’s a proactive step towards safeguarding your funds and ensuring a fair and enjoyable gaming experience.

Decoding Casino Bonus Offers
Casino bonuses are a common incentive used by operators to attract new players and reward existing ones. They come in various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can significantly enhance your gameplay, it's crucial to understand the associated terms and conditions before claiming them. Wagering requirements are arguably the most important factor to consider. These requirements specify the amount of money you must wager before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. A high wagering requirement can substantially diminish the value of a bonus, making it difficult to cash out your winnings.
Other important terms to be aware of include game restrictions, maximum bet limits, and bonus expiry dates. Some bonuses may only be valid for specific games, while others may have a maximum bet size that you're allowed to place while using bonus funds. Bonuses also typically have an expiry date, after which they become void. Failing to meet the wagering requirements or adhere to the terms and conditions can result in the forfeiture of both the bonus and any associated winnings. Therefore, careful scrutiny of the bonus terms is essential to avoid disappointment.

Responsible Gambling Practices
Responsible gambling is paramount for ensuring a safe and enjoyable online casino experience. It involves setting limits on your time and money spent gambling, and recognizing the signs of problem gambling. Setting a budget before you start playing is crucial, and sticking to it regardless of whether you're winning or losing. Avoid chasing losses, as this can quickly lead to financial difficulties. Similarly, it's important to set time limits for your gambling sessions and take regular breaks. Gambling should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income.
If you feel that your gambling is becoming problematic, there are resources available to help. Organizations such as GamCare and BeGambleAware offer confidential support and guidance for individuals struggling with gambling addiction. These organizations can provide counseling, financial advice, and self-exclusion options. Self-exclusion allows you to voluntarily ban yourself from gambling sites for a specific period of time, providing a valuable tool for regaining control.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ling – such as spending more money than you can afford, lying about your gambling habits, or neglecting other responsibilities – is the first step towards seeking help.
Tools and Resources for Responsible Gambling
Many online casinos offer a range of tools to promote responsible gambling, including deposit limits, loss limits, session time lim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its allow you to restrict the amount of money you can deposit into your account over a specific period. Loss limits cap the amount of money you can lose within a given timeframe. Session time limits track how long you've been playing and prompt you to take a break. Self-exclusion allows you to voluntarily ban yourself from the casino for a set period. Utilizing these tools can help you stay in control of your gambling and prevent it from becoming a problem.
Beyond casino-provided tools, several independent organizations offer support and resources for responsible gambling. GamCare (www.gamcare.org.uk) provides confidential advice and support via phone, email, and online chat. BeGambleAware (www.begambleaware.org) offers information and resources on problem gambling, as well as a national helpline. Gamblers Anonymous (www.gamblersanonymous.org.uk) provides support groups for individuals struggling with gambling addiction. Remember, se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. Navigating Payment Methods at Online Casinos
When engaging with online casinos, understanding the available payment methods is essential. Common options include debit cards (Visa, Mastercard), e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and prepaid cards. Each method comes with its own set of advantages and disadvantages regarding speed, security, and fees. Debit cards are widely accepted but may have slower processing times than e-wallets. E-wallets offer enhanced security and faster transactions, but may incur fees. Bank transfers are generally secure but can take several business days to process. Prepaid cards offer anonymity but may have lower deposit limits.
Security is a primary concern when choosing a payment method. Ensure the casino uses SSL encryption to protect your financial information. Reputable casinos will also be PCI DSS compliant, meaning they adhere to industry standards for handling credit card data. Before making a deposit, check the casino's withdrawal policy, as different methods may have different processing times and withdrawal limits. It’s also important to be aware of any potential fees associated with deposits or withdrawals. Choosing a secure and convenient payment method is crucial for a hassle-free online casino experience.
